This article made me so happy. DESIGN MATTERS. HOW SOMETHING LOOKS INFLUENCES CONSUMER EXPERIENCE. Consumer experience is largely emotional. Design is a way of triggering emotions to support and align with user experience. As someone who's foundation is rooted in the psychology of design, I feel like I've been hollering into dead space, as I'm sure many designers do. Steve Jobs knew that design sets expectations and creates a psychological environment that frames product use. The whole field of Data Viz is built on design choices to communicate. Design (or lack of it) is one of the reasons I've never used Google Mail in spite of it's functionality. It's just TOO UGLY. Developers take note. This isn't about Millennials. It's about design.
